NN9 6ES is a residential postcode located on Spinney Street, Raunds, Wellingborough, NN9. It is the 602nd largest postcode in the NN9 area.
It contains 33 houses and 15 unknown and the most common type of property is a early-century house built between 1912 and 1935.
The average house value is £208,306. Sales values have decreased in the last 12 months by 0.5% and Rental values have increased by 5.2%.
Property sale values range from £158,681 for a freehold house, with 2 bedrooms split across 426 square feet of gross internal area and has a garden to £317,472 for a freehold house, with 4 bedrooms split across 1,572 square feet of gross internal area and has a garden.
Average £/ft2 for properties in NN9 6ES is £297/ft2.
Properties achieve a rental yield of between 5.4% and 5.9%, and rental values range from £776 to £1,419 per month.
The last sale was 27 Mar 2023 for £195,000 and since then the market in the area has decreased by -0.7%. The postcode has had a total of 4 sales since 1995.
NN9 6ES has seen 3 sales in the last three years and no sales in the last twelve months.
